Subject: Locker reassignments — Brindlewood House changing rooms

Reception,

Lockers 12–20 in the lower changing room were cleared over the weekend for the new Halvorsen Group starters. Assign in order, one per person, and note the number against their name in the locker register. Anyone claiming a previous assignment goes to Facilities, not us. Old padlocks in the grey bin behind the desk can be handed out if asked. The changing room corridor door now requires a pass. Use the code below until the badge readers are reprogrammed.

badge for badup-kahif: bdg-LHI-9

Status: the Halvorsen Castings agreement lapses in ninety days. Pricing acceptable; quality metrics stable; one late-delivery penalty invoked last year. Procurement recommends a two-year renewal with a tightened service-level schedule. Legal review is complete. Risks: single-source exposure on precision housings; mitigation options costed and filed. Your decision is needed within three weeks to avoid rollover on legacy terms. Full dossier is in the contracts archive. A confidential planning note is appended directly below.

confidential, yaweg-bafog: The western region missed its Druael quota by 42.1 percent last quarter. Wenokix Group plans to raise the Alddor list price by 36.3 percent in June. The finance team signed off on a budget of $272.6 million for Project Rusax. The renewal with Istiusix Systems closes at $334.2 million a year, 62.9 percent below the last contract.

Subject: Cursor pagination rollout — Wavelet API

For this week's sync: the public Wavelet REST API now defaults to cursor-based pagination, replacing offset pages. Offset parameters remain accepted through the deprecation window but emit a warning header. We load-tested cursors against the largest tenant dataset with no regressions; deep-page latency dropped substantially. Client SDKs were regenerated and published this morning. Please review the migration notes before Thursday. The canary deployment we validated is tagged below.

session token of taduf-tahog = htk4_91a1